Ingredients
- 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(about 1.5 lbs.)
- 1 cup honey
- 1/3 cup soy sauce
- 4 cloves garlic (minced)
- 1 tablespoon grated ginger
- 1 bell pepper (chopped)
- 2 cups broccoli florets
- 1 cup sliced carrots
- 1 cup snap peas
- Salt and pepper (to taste)
- 1 tablespoon cornstarch (optional)
- 2 tablespoons water (optional)
Instructions
- Place chicken breasts at the bottom of the slow cooker.
- In a mixing bowl, combine honey, soy sauce, minced garlic, and grated ginger. Pour over chicken.
- Add chopped bell pepper, broccoli florets, sliced carrots, and snap peas. Stir gently.
- Season with salt and pepper to taste.
- Cover and cook on low for 6 hours.
- If desired, mix cornstarch with water about 30 minutes before serving to thicken the sauce.
- Shred the chicken using two forks before serving hot.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 6 hours
